The skin is our largest organ and forms a protective layer against external influences. Yet various factors can cause the skin to become unbalanced and cause symptoms. They are common and can range from mild and temporary to chronic and severe.

A skin problem is an abnormality or condition of the skin that can cause changes in appearance, structure or function of the skin. The most common skin problems range from mild irritations to chronic conditions.
Below is an overview of common skin problems:

Acne

A common skin disease in which sebaceous glands become clogged and inflamed, leading to pimples, blackheads and sometimes painful bumps.

Acne scars

As acne heals, scars can sometimes be left behind that vary in shape and depth, such as pits or thickening in the skin.

Dull skin

Skin that lacks its natural radiance and freshness, often due to reduced cell turnover, dehydration or accumulation of dead skin cells.

Hair loss

Reduction of hair density due to loss of hair, which can be temporary or permanent due to various causes such as heredity, stress, diet or disease.

Pigmentation spots

Dark spots on the skin due to accumulation of pigment (melanin), often caused by sun exposure, aging or hormonal changes.

Wrinkles and fine lines

Lines and grooves caused by aging, reduction of collagen and elastin, sun damage and facial expression.

Puffiness and dark circles

Dark discoloration and/or puffiness under the eyes caused by fatigue, heredity, thin skin or poor circulation.

Sagging skin

With aging, the production of collagen, elastin and fatty tissue decreases, causing the skin to sag.

Stem warts

Small, soft, skin-colored or light brown warts that often appear on the neck, armpits or around the eyes and are usually harmless.

Cellulite

Cellulite occurs in 80-90% of women because their connective tissue and fat structure are structured differently than in men.
